When movies are made into books there are bound to be differences, that is just the way it is. And I will admit, I have sat in the theater on opening weekend for every one of the Twilight movies (other than the last). I have also read each of the books, I just couldn’t help myself.

I have noted the differences between the movie and the book, and there are plenty of them. Here I will only mention a few.

There is no mention of a Cullen Family Crest in the book, but in the movie all of the Cullens are wearing some sort of crest as an accessory on their persons.

The field trip they take to the greenhouse does not exist in the book.

The scene where Edward takes Bella to his house, he is supposed to play her the lullaby. Instead, everyone is cooking for her. The lullaby is an integral part, because it leads up to him showing her the rest of the house thus leading into introducing her to rest of the family.

Charlie and Bella only eat at the diner a few times in the book, in the movie they eat there a lot.
